DSplayer Posted November 6, 2021 Posted November 6, 2021 (edited) With 2.7.7, the JF-17's detection range has stayed relatively the same but holding and acquiring tracks beyond ~40nm in look up and maybe ~30nm in look down has significantly diminished compared to 2.7.6. Sometimes when you're trying to bug someone that has a track file built in TWS beyond ~40nm or in a look down, it doesn't stay bugged and you'll drop the track pretty quickly (even if the target is hot). I'm a bit curious to how accurate the radar is now compared to the real deal or if it even is supposed to act this way.
